Cavan woman Tina Kellegher says starring in the iconic film the Snapper was very enjoyable and she says it was a gift.
Tina says she still gets younger people who are only discovering the film now telling her how much they liked it.
The low budget film was released 32 years ago and is one of the best-loved Irish films of all times and always a big hit over the festive period.
Twenty-year-old Sharon Curley played by Tina Kellegher finds herself after a boozy night on the town, pregnant and refuses to divulge the identity of the baby's father.
Eventually, the not-so-proud dad is exposed, bringing new levels of embarrassment and complication to the devout Roman Catholic Curley household.
Tina who lives in Mullingar but who grew up in Cavan says the movie holds a special place in the hearts of many Irish families.
